Diodes - Zener - Single

1. Overview

Single Zener diodes are discrete semiconductor devices designed to operate in the reverse breakdown region, maintaining a stable voltage across a wide range of currents. Based on the Zener effect and avalanche breakdown mechanisms, these components are critical for voltage regulation, reference, and protection circuits. They serve as foundational elements in power supplies, analog circuits, and precision measurement systems, ensuring reliability in electronics ranging from consumer devices to industrial equipment.

2. Main Types and Functional Classification

TypeFunctional CharacteristicsApplication Examples
Low-Voltage Zener (2.4V-10V)Utilizes Zener effect with sharp breakdown characteristicsVoltage references, comparator circuits
Mid-Voltage Zener (10V-100V)Combines Zener and avalanche breakdownPower supply regulation, clamping circuits
High-Voltage Zener (>100V)Primarily avalanche breakdown mechanismHigh-voltage protection, industrial controls
Surface-Mount (SMD) ZenerMiniaturized packaging for automated assemblyMobile devices, wearable electronics

3. Structure and Composition

Single Zener diodes consist of a heavily doped PN junction semiconductor structure, typically fabricated from silicon. The cathode terminal is marked with a band, while the anode connects to the P-type material. Advanced devices employ passivation layers (e.g., silicon dioxide) to improve stability and reliability. Common packaging includes axial leaded (DO-35, DO-41) and surface-mount (SOD-123, SOT-23) formats with glass or plastic encapsulation for environmental protection.

4. Key Technical Specifications

ParameterDescriptionImportance
Zener Voltage (Vz)Specified reverse breakdown voltage at test currentDetermines operating voltage level
Power Dissipation (Pz)Maximum power handling capabilityDefines thermal management requirements
Dynamic Impedance (Zz)AC resistance affecting voltage stabilityImpacts regulation performance
Temperature Coefficient (TC)Voltage drift per degree CelsiusCritical for precision applications
Reverse Leakage Current (Ir)Off-state current at rated voltageAffects power efficiency

7. Selection Guidelines

Key considerations:

  1. Determine required Vz with 5% margin over operating current range
  2. Calculate Pz = Vz maximum expected current
  3. Select package type based on board space and thermal requirements
  4. For precision applications, prioritize TC < 100ppm/ C and low Zz
  5. Consider automotive-grade parts for harsh environments
